WebMay 16, 2004 · Because sources of ignition are a primary concern in explosive atmospheres, it is often necessary to provide a more enhanced protection system of handling static electricity in hazardous locations. Therefore, many engineering designs in these types of electrical installations incorporate a system of protection from static electricity. WebJul 12, 2012 · This test determines the lowest temperature capable of igniting a dust dispersed in the form of a cloud. The MIT is an important factor in evaluating the ignition sensitivity of dusts to such ignition sources as heated environments, hot surfaces (electric motors), and friction sparks. The primary objective is to perform tests to determine the viability of various ignition sources to ignite A2L refrigerants in air. Fifteen ignition sources were identified and tested. The A2L refrigerants tested were R-32, R-452B, R-1234yf, and R-1234ze. WebMar 15, 2024 · * All ignition sources capable of igniting the dust cloud are removed, or * People and facilities are protected against the consequences of an explosion by suitable “protection measures”. Avoiding formation of explosive dusts clouds should always be the primary objective. WebJan 13, 2016 · The primary influences upon how bushfires move through the landscape are humidity, geography, wind and temperature. Humidity and temperature. The effects of ambient temperature and humidity on a fire are pretty obvious. The hotter the air temperature, the closer any fuel is to its ignition point, and dry fuel will burn more easily.
